引言
在信息爆炸的时代,数据可视化成为了传递信息、辅助决策的重要手段。Echarts,作为一款强大的数据可视化库,因其易用性和丰富的图表类型,受到了广大开发者的喜爱。今天,我们就来一起探讨如何从零基础开始,通过视频教程轻松掌握Echarts,开启你的数据可视化之旅。
Echarts简介
什么是Echarts?
Echarts是一个使用JavaScript实现的开源可视化库,它提供了一整套数据可视化解决方案,可以轻松实现各种图表的绘制。Echarts具有以下特点:
- 丰富的图表类型:包括折线图、柱状图、饼图、散点图、地图等,满足不同场景的需求。
- 高度可定制:支持丰富的配置项,可以轻松调整图表的样式、颜色、布局等。
- 跨平台:支持多种浏览器和操作系统,无需担心兼容性问题。
为什么选择Echarts?
- 易学易用:Echarts的API设计简洁明了,即使是初学者也能快速上手。
- 社区活跃:Echarts拥有庞大的开发者社区,遇到问题时可以快速得到帮助。
- 性能优越:Echarts采用了多种优化技术,保证了图表的流畅性和响应速度。
从零基础到实战入门
第一步:了解基础知识
在开始学习Echarts之前,我们需要了解一些基础知识,包括:
- HTML/CSS/JavaScript:Echarts是基于JavaScript开发的,因此需要掌握这些基本的前端技术。
- 数据结构:了解常见的数据结构,如数组、对象等,有助于我们更好地理解Echarts的数据处理方式。
第二步:学习Echarts基本用法
通过视频教程,我们可以学习以下内容:
- Echarts的基本概念:了解Echarts的组成部分,如图表容器、配置项、系列等。
- 图表类型:学习不同图表类型的绘制方法,如折线图、柱状图、饼图等。
- 配置项:掌握Echarts的配置项,包括图表的样式、颜色、布局等。
第三步:实战演练
通过以下实战案例,我们可以巩固所学知识:
- 绘制一个简单的折线图:展示如何使用Echarts绘制基本的折线图,并调整其样式和颜色。
- 制作一个动态的饼图:学习如何使用Echarts实现饼图的动态效果,如动画、数据更新等。
- 地图可视化:了解如何使用Echarts绘制地图,并展示地理数据。
第四步:进阶学习
在掌握了Echarts的基本用法后,我们可以进一步学习以下内容:
- 高级图表:学习绘制高级图表,如雷达图、漏斗图、K线图等。
- 数据交互:了解如何实现图表与用户之间的交互,如点击事件、拖拽等。
- 性能优化:学习如何优化Echarts的性能,提高图表的渲染速度。
总结
通过以上步骤,我们可以从零基础开始,通过视频教程轻松掌握Echarts,并应用于实际项目中。数据可视化不再难,让我们一起开启这段精彩的旅程吧!
